Office Administrator/ Coordinator
We are searching for versatile and experienced Office Assistants to join the Undersea Systems Office (USO) at the Applied Research Laboratory (ARL) at Penn State. USO serves as a research center of excellence in undersea weapons, unmanned undersea vehicles, and advanced sonars supporting our national security and undersea warfare sponsors through the development and demonstration of science and technology with the expertise, tools, and processes to take concepts from the early developmental phase through transition to industry and the fleet.
We support our national security and undersea warfare sponsors through the development and demonstration of science and technology with the expertise, tools, and processes to take concepts from the early developmental phase through transition to industry and the fleet.
ARL is an authorized DoD Skill Bridge partner and welcomes all transitioning military members to apply.
You will:Coordinate a large volume of complex domestic and international travel in support of program engineers (researching visit requirements, booking reservations, arranging schedules, and reconciling travel expenses)
Provide support for a wide variety of meetings (scheduling rooms, preparing agendas/ meeting materials, overseeing meeting logistics including audio-visual setups, security, refreshments, and vendor-delivered meals)
Manage data, files, and calendars
Provide coordination and oversight for external visitors, ensuring that security guidelines and requirements are followed
Communicate with and provide exceptional customer service for internal and external stakeholders (government, industry, University, and ARL-specific)
Assist with all administrative aspects of hiring and onboarding of new hires
Prepare classified material including presentations, engineering documents, mailings and data transfers in compliance with requirements of the Defense Counterintelligence and Security Agency (DCSA)
Proofread documents for appropriate security markings, grammar, spelling, punctuation, and basic formatting
Microsoft Office (Word, PowerPoint, Excel and Outlook)
Agility in managing multiple competing priorities
Resolve issues and prioritize work, both independently and as a team member, in support of multiple unit and program leaders
Demonstrated ability to exercise discretion and confidentiality
Success in an office environment, where various forms of communication and organizational skills were crucial to be effective
Current eligibility to obtain a clearance at the Secret level
Your working location will be fully onsite, located in State College, PA.

ARL’s purpose is to research and develop innovative solutions to challenging scientific, engineering, and technology problems in support of the Navy, the Department of Defense (DoD), and the Intel Community (IC).
BACKGROUND CHECKS/CLEARANCESEmployment with the University will require successful completion of background check(s) in accordance with University policies.
Notice regarding employment at the Applied Research Laboratory (ARL):
Employees must be eligible to obtain a government security clearance, participate in the ARL drug testing program, and comply with electronic and physical monitoring requirements applicable to federal contractors. ARL operates in a secure information environment involving Unclassified,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I), and Classified information. Personal electronic devices brought onsite must be registered and may be restricted from certain areas. You must be a U.S. citizen to apply.
& BENEFITS
The salary range for this position, including all possible grades, is $46,800.00 - $77,304.00.
